当前位置: 首页 > news >正文

WSL 基础命令

 Windows Subsystem for Linux(WSL)是微软为 Windows 系统提供的一项功能,允许用户在 Windows 上直接运行原生的 Linux 命令行工具、应用程序和脚本,而无需传统虚拟机(如 VirtualBox、VMware)或双系统启动。

# 查看可通过在线商店获得的 Linux 发行版列表。 此命令也可输入为:wsl -l -o。
wsl --list --online
#查看安装在 Windows 计算机上的 Linux 发行版列表,其中包括状态(发行版是正在运行还是已停止)和运行发行版的 WSL 版本(WSL 1 或 WSL 2)。
wsl --list --verbose# 运行 Ubuntu
wsl -d Ubuntu-22.04# 运行-以特定用户 wsl --distribution <Distribution Name> --user <User Name>
wsl --distribution Ubuntu-22.04 --user root# 更改分发版登录的默认用户: <Distribution Name> config --default-user <User Name>
#将 Ubuntu 分发的默认用户更改为“root”用户
ubuntu2204.exe config --default-user root# 终止运行 wsl --terminate <Distribution Name>;重置 Ubuntu-22.04 运行
wsl --terminate Ubuntu-22.04# 卸载 wsl --unregister <DistributionName>
wsl --unregister Ubuntu-22.04# 关机
wsl --shutdown# 修改密码 在Ubuntu 系统中 输入 passwd  再输入密码即可
passwd

参考链接:设置 WSL 开发环境 | Microsoft Learn

相关文章:

  • DeepSeek+白果AI论文:开启答辩PPT生成的「智能双引擎」时代
  • AI大模型(三)openAI大模型应用
  • 《100天精通Python——基础篇 2025 第20天:Thread类与线程同步机制详解》
  • 『uniapp』uni-share 分享功能 使用例子(保姆级图文)
  • java线程中断的艺术
  • 绿色屋顶和墙壁行业2025数据分析报告
  • 【批量文件夹重命名】如何按照Excel表格对应的关系,批量一对一的重命名文件夹,文件夹按照对应映射关系一对一改名
  • 打破产品思维--启示录:打造用户喜欢的产品--实战6
  • RocketMq的消息类型及代码案例
  • [C++面试] 基础题 11~20
  • 归一化 超全总结!!
  • 编译rk3568的buildroot不起作用
  • pvlib(太阳轨迹)
  • 基于CodeBuddy实现本地网速的实时浏览小工具
  • 算法题(154):合并果子
  • [NOIP 2003 普及组] 麦森数 Java
  • 由浮点数的位级表示判断大小关系
  • 电子电路:为什么导体中的电子数量能够始终保持不变?
  • VBA 读取指定范围内的单元格数据,生成csv文件
  • [软件测试_5] 设计用例 | 等价法 | 判定表法 | 正交法(allpairs.exe)
  • 网站的小图标怎么做的/河南网站seo推广
  • 网站用什么语言/找文网客服联系方式
  • 自己建网站模板/优化关键词是什么意思
  • 泰安网站建设推广/在线识别图片来源
  • 优秀网站的必备要素/在哪里可以发布自己的广告
  • ps做专业网站/引流推广网站